Advent Week Two: Peace ~ Day Five

Today's devotion is from guest blogger, Kris.

Luke 10:2-6
Therefore said he unto them, The harvest truly is great, but the laborers are few: pray ye therefore the Lord of the harvest, that he would send forth laborers into his harvest. Go your ways: behold, I send you forth as lambs among wolves. Carry neither purse, nor scrip, nor shoes: and salute no man by the way. And into whatsoever house ye enter, first say, Peace be to this house. And if the son of peace be there, your peace shall rest upon it: if not, it shall turn to you again.

How would you like to impact every house you enter, every place of business, and every person you meet? Sound impossible? It isn’t. Jesus sent out his disciples to go among the people. He gave them a few instructions: carry neither purse or money or extra shoes because, Jesus was saying, God would provide for them. And the second set of instructions was to bring peace everywhere they went by saying “Peace be to this house.” If the household was one of of peace they would be blessed, but if not, then the blessing would return to the disciple.

If everywhere you go and to everyone you meet, you give a blessing of peace you can influence lives for good. If they do not want your blessing, no problem, it will come back to rest on you.

How would your town be different if there was true peace? How would your neighbors be blessed if you brought peace with you on a visit? No one is insignificant. You can make a difference. You do not have to be brave or loud, nor bold and brash, but you can be you and share the gift of peace.

Prayer: Lord help me to be a bringer of peace to those around me. Remind me when I enter a house to bless them. May my teachers know me as a person of peace, may my employers see that peace follows me at work, and may neighbors want me to visit because of the peaceful nature that comes with me as I walk in your instruction. Amen
